Gyazo features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    Gyazo offers a straightforward interface that allows users to capture and share screenshots with minimal effort.
  • Quick Sharing
    It automatically uploads images to the cloud immediately after capturing, providing a direct link for easy sharing.
  • Cross-Platform Support
    Gyazo is available on multiple platforms, including Windows, macOS, Linux, iOS, and Android, ensuring broad accessibility.
  • GIF and Video Capture
    In addition to screenshots, Gyazo allows users to capture animated GIFs and short videos, which can be useful for demonstrations.
  • Image History
    Registered users can view and manage their image history, keeping track of previous screenshots and uploads.

Possible disadvantages of Gyazo

  • Limited Free Features
    The free version of Gyazo is quite limited, offering basic functionalities while more advanced features require a subscription.
  • Privacy Concerns
    As images are immediately uploaded to the cloud, there might be privacy issues if sensitive data is inadvertently shared.
  • Subscription Cost
    Gyazo's premium features, such as unlimited screen recording and additional editing tools, are accessible only with a paid subscription.
  • Dependency on Internet
    Since the application relies on cloud uploading for image sharing, an active internet connection is necessary for full functionality.
  • Limited Editing Tools
    Compared to some other similar tools, Gyazo offers relatively basic editing features, which might not meet the needs of power users.

Koding features and specs

  • Integrated Development Environment (IDE)
    Koding offers an integrated development environment that supports multiple programming languages, which streamlines the development process by providing tools and features in one platform.
  • Cloud-based
    Being a cloud-based platform, Koding allows you to work on your projects from anywhere with an internet connection, fostering better collaboration and convenience.
  • Pre-configured Environments
    Koding provides pre-configured development environments for various technologies, allowing users to bypass lengthy setup processes and start coding immediately.
  • Collaboration Features
    The platform includes collaboration tools such as shared terminals and real-time code collaboration, which are useful for team projects and pair programming.
  • Scalability
    Koding's infrastructure can scale according to the needs of the user, making it suitable for both individual developers and larger development teams.

Possible disadvantages of Koding

  • Pricing
    While Koding offers a free tier, more advanced features and greater resources typically require a paid subscription, which might not be affordable for all users.
  • Performance
    Some users have reported performance issues, especially when working with more resource-intensive projects, as cloud environments can occasionally be slower compared to local machines.
  • Learning Curve
    Although it is feature-rich, the platform can be intimidating for beginners due to its complex interface and extensive toolset.
  • Dependency on Internet
    As a cloud-based platform, Koding requires a stable internet connection for optimal performance, which might be a limitation in areas with poor connectivity.
  • Limited Customization
    Users might find the pre-configured environments limiting if they have specific customization requirements that are not supported out of the box.
